Antwort
 
LinkBack Themen-Optionen Thema bewerten Ansicht
  #1  
Alt 22.03.06, 20:49
Forum Zuschauer
 
Registriert seit: 22.03.06
Beiträge: 1

Das kickstarter <table> layout umbauen


Hallo zusammen,

hab soeben meine erste Extension mit dem Kickstarter zusammengebaut und auch schon die entsprechenden .php dateien angepasst.
soweit so gut. jetzt hab ich das Problem, dass mir das standard layout von der Extension Tables in meinen Quellcode packt:

z.B. so:
Code:
<!--

		BEGIN: Content of extension "sppl", plugin "tx_sppl_pi1"

	-->

	<div class="tx-sppl-pi1">
		

		<!--
			Record list:
		-->
		<div class="tx-sppl-pi1-listrow">
			<table>
				<tr>
				
				<td valign="top"><p><b>Bla Bla Bla</b></p></td>
				<td valign="top"><p>Tuesday 10. January 2006</p></td>
				<td valign="top"><p>Sunday 12. March 2006</p></td>

				<td valign="top"><p><img src="uploads/tx_sppl/content_bsp.jpg" width="114" height="113" border="0" alt="" title="" /></p></td>
				<td valign="top"><p>lorem ipsum ... </p></td>
			</tr>
			</table>
		</div>
	</div>
	<!-- END: Content of extension "sppl", plugin "tx_sppl_pi1" -->
ich hätts aber lieber so (für jeden Datenbankeintrag) :

Code:
<div style="padding:10px;background-image:url(fileadmin/pics/content_bg.jpg);width:684px;height:117px;font-size:11px;"><img src="uploads/tx_sppl/content_bsp.jpg" alt="" style="float:left;border:none;margin-right:10px;" />
10. Januar 2006 - 12. März 2006<br />
<br />
<b>bla bla bla</b><br />
<br />
lorem ipsum ...</div>
Wie kann man das bewerkstelligen? Das haben mir die Videotutorials leider nicht verraten. In der class.tx_sppl_pi1.php kann ich zwar die <tr>s verändern aber die <table> aussen rum bleibt ja leider immer bestehen!?

Vielen Dank im Voraus ,
.phreak
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 09.10.06, 15:22
Forum Zuschauer
 
Registriert seit: 26.09.06
Beiträge: 8

lösung?


hallo!
hast du dafür irgendeine lösung erhalten/gefunden? falls ja, wäre ich sehr interessiert daran, da ich momentan das selbe problem habe!

danke und gruss
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#3  
Alt 26.10.06, 21:44
Forum Newbie
 
Registriert seit: 15.01.06
Alter: 34
Beiträge: 26

dito, ich stehe gerade total aufm schlauch wo das überhaupt definiert ist... und wie ich es überschreiben kann?
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#4  
Alt 27.10.06, 17:26
Benutzerbild von maxhb
TYPO3 Forum Team
Moderator
 
Registriert seit: 19.08.04
Ort: Bremen
Alter: 37
Beiträge: 1.547

Hi!
Nach dem Erstellen und Installieren der Extension sollten unter /typo3conf/ext/deine_extension diverse Dateien abgelegt worden sein. unter andrem gibt es dort ein Verzeichnis pioder pi1, in dem findet ihr eine Datei class.tx_deineextension.php.
In dieser Datei findest ihr den PHP-Code, der die Ausgabe der Extension erzeugt. Mit ein wenig PHP-Kenntnissen könnt ihr dort eure Anpassungen vornehmen.

CU
maxhb
__________________
FreeBSD || MySQL 5.x || TYPO3 3.6 - 4.2

Meine Stadt, meine Firma, mein Redaktionssystem.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#5  
Alt 27.10.06, 18:44
Forum Newbie
 
Registriert seit: 15.01.06
Alter: 34
Beiträge: 26

ja klar... aber hier hat man dan nicht direkt die möglichkeit diese ausgabe zu verändern...

ich habe es so gelöst das ich die entsprechende funktion lokalisiert habe und diese aufrufe...

function pi_list_makelist_lokal($res,$tableParams='') {
// Make list table header:
....
}
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#6  
Alt 27.10.06, 19:15
Benutzerbild von maxhb
TYPO3 Forum Team
Moderator
 
Registriert seit: 19.08.04
Ort: Bremen
Alter: 37
Beiträge: 1.547

Zitat:
Zitat von karob
ja klar... aber hier hat man dan nicht direkt die möglichkeit diese ausgabe zu verändern...
Und in welcher Datei hast Du dann Deine Änderungen eingepflegt?!

CU
maxhb
__________________
FreeBSD || MySQL 5.x || TYPO3 3.6 - 4.2

Meine Stadt, meine Firma, mein Redaktionssystem.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#7  
Alt 27.10.06, 19:21
Forum Newbie
 
Registriert seit: 15.01.06
Alter: 34
Beiträge: 26

in der class-XXX-.php im pi ordner wird die funktion pi_list_makelist aufgerufen, diese findest du in der der datei class.tslib_pibase.php.

die funktion einfach in die class-XXX-.php kopieren umbenennen und den aufruf anpassen. und schon kannst du für diese extension die funktion anpassen.

ansonsten würdest du die änderung ja global machen. geht natürlich auch vorrausgesetzt du möchtest die änderung überall.
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#8  
Alt 18.01.08, 10:12
Forum Stammgast
 
Registriert seit: 11.01.08
Ort: Oberfranken
Alter: 21
Beiträge: 252

Ich weiss dieses Thema ist schon recht alt. Ich möchte aber trotzdem etwas hinzufügen.

Am einfachsten geht es, wenn man in seiner class.tx_xxx_pi1.php beim Funktionsaufruf pi_list_makelist($res) einfach schreibt pi_list_makelist($res,"Tableparamerter").

z.B.
$fullTable.=$this->pi_list_makelist($res,'border="0" cellpadding="3" cellspacing="0" align="center" width="570"');

Gruss Tycho
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Gelöst Mehrere Installationen - eine source: wie muss ich mein typo umbauen? yannis TYPO3 4.x Installation und Updates 6 29.02.08 12:48
Navigation umbauen theidmann TYPO3 4.x Fragen und Probleme 2 04.12.07 09:38
$this->doc->table() + Layout ändern moon76 Extension modifizieren oder neu erstellen 5 07.08.07 12:38
KB Content Table bbzg Alle anderen Extensions 0 11.06.06 13:23
Type table, Layout 5 ohne images? M8TRIX TYPO3 3.x Fragen und Probleme 1 13.12.04 12:02


Alle Zeitangaben in WEZ +1. Es ist jetzt 08:17 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0